Over the Range
by Ion L Idriess
Over the Range is a 1937 book by Australian author Ion L. Idriess. It tells the story of a police patrol in the Kimberley region of Western Australia in 1933. The patrol, led by Constable Laurie O'Neill, is tasked with tracking down a group of cattle spearers who have been terrorizing the region.The patrol travels through some of the most remote and rugged terrain in Australia. They face heat, thirst, and danger at every turn. Along the way, they encounter Aboriginal people, wild animals, and the harsh...

Tracks
by Robyn Davidson
Robyn Davidson was born in Queensland, Australia, and is the author of Tracks, the extraordinary account of her 1,700-mile journey across Australia with four camels, which won the 1980 Thomas Cook Travel Book Award and became a film in 2013. She has written extensively for National Geographic and other magazines, and is also the author of Desert Places, the novel Ancestors, and the essay collection Travelling Light. Ms. Davidson lives in London, India, and Australia.
